How to Use eSIM on Samsung Galaxy S24, S25 & Z Fold/Flip
Detailed guide for setting up eSIM on Samsung Galaxy smartphones, including the S24 series, S25 series, and foldable Z Fold and Z Flip models.
Samsung's Galaxy lineup has embraced eSIM technology across its flagship phones. Whether you have an S24, S25, Z Fold, or Z Flip, setting up an eSIM for travel data is straightforward. Here's how.
Compatible Samsung Devices
- Galaxy S21, S22, S23, S24, S25 (all variants including Ultra)
- Galaxy Z Fold 3, 4, 5, 6
- Galaxy Z Flip 3, 4, 5, 6
- Some Galaxy A series (A54 5G and later)
Note: Some regional variants may not support eSIM. Check Settings > Connections > SIM Manager. If you see an "Add eSIM" option, your phone supports it.
Installation Steps
- Open Settings
- Tap Connections
- Tap SIM Manager
- Tap Add eSIM
- Select Scan QR code from service provider
- Point your camera at the QR code from MobiaL
- Tap Add when prompted
- Wait for the profile to download and install
- Name the eSIM (e.g., "Travel Data")
Configuring for Travel
After installation, configure your dual SIM setup:
- Go to Settings > Connections > SIM Manager
- Under "Mobile data," select your travel eSIM
- Under "Calls" and "Messages," keep your home SIM selected
- Enable "Data roaming" for the travel eSIM if prompted
Samsung also offers a "Smart Dual SIM" feature that automatically optimizes which SIM handles data based on signal strength.
Samsung-Specific Tips
- One UI shortcuts: Pull down the notification shade and long-press the SIM card icon for quick switching between lines
- Battery optimization: Samsung's aggressive battery management may restrict background data on your travel eSIM. Go to Settings > Battery > Background usage limits and make sure essential apps aren't restricted
- Data usage monitoring: Samsung's built-in data monitor shows usage per SIM, so you can track your travel data consumption
Troubleshooting
"No SIM Manager" Option
Your Samsung model may not support eSIM, or it may be a carrier-locked variant with eSIM disabled. Contact your carrier or check Samsung's official compatibility list for your model number.
eSIM Profile Won't Download
Ensure you have a stable internet connection. Clear the cache of the SIM Manager app (Settings > Apps > SIM Manager > Storage > Clear cache). Restart and try again.
